We know a few families who have had their children suddenly snatched from this life. This poem isn’t about us or anyone imparticular but probably a combination of all. It is written from an outsider’s perspective looking in. It is such a devastating situation. Highly emotional, painful, raw and so awkward for those on the outside to watch all the grief and pain happening.

Too many Tears
Too many tears from so few eyes
Blue days become their retched skies
Broken lives in huddled weeping
Bellowed cries make restless sleeping
But how each day do they arise?
Will he check out in death’s demise?
As she breaks down without goodbyes?
Watch love’s torment slowly reaping
Too many tears
Packaged attempts to sympathise
Plainly will not relieve their cries
Compassion knocks with eyes seeping
“Passing by… how are you keeping?
Please carry on but don’t disguise
Too many tears”
